Curriculum

  • What is Open Source Material?
  • Value of open source software - exploiting free tools - recognising limitations
  • Legislation – detailed knowledge of legislation relevant to commercial investigation - Legal Considerations including Agent Provocateur, False on-line accounts, Social Engineering, GDPR
  • Open Source v Undercover - The difference!
  • Intelligence Development using open source
  • Information > Intelligence > Evidence
  • OSINT Resource Set-up
  • Equipment needs & wishes
  • Software choices
  • Connection to the Internet
  • Advanced evidential capture features - use of Camtasia, Snagit & others
  • Hashing: Concepts, Capability & Value
  • How the Internet & WWW function from an OSINT perspective
  • Communications Data Awareness – including MAC addressing, resolution of IP addressing
  • Web Browsers – preparing a browser for OSINT
  • Network footprints & what is left by researchers
  • Introduction to Internet Searching - basic, targeted & meta search
  • Open Source software options
  • Social Networks & Media - Understanding of contents & capabilities - searching platforms
  • People & business searching – getting the most data & using it effectively
  • Locations & Mapping
  • Image/document metadata and geolocation
  • Understanding HTML code
  • Emails, Newsgroups & market places
  • VPNs & the Dark Web - Darknet - setting up and using TOR, Freenet, etc
  • Virtual/Crypto Currencies
  • Forensic Linguistics - introduction & basic knowledge
  • Documents - identification
  • Using Smartphone & Tablet devices for OSINT
  • Encryption & Steganography - introductory level, work based knowledge
  • Information & Intelligence Packages - producing a product

Exam Track

During your course, you'll prepare for and sit the Open Source Investigator - Advanced Practitioner exam, covered by your Certification Guarantee.

The exam is divided into two parts:

  • Practical Assessment
    • Duration: 2 hours
    • Format: online
  • Written Assessment
    • Duration: 2 hours
    • Format: online, multiple choice
